Skip to content

styledown/styledown-rails

Repository files navigation

Styledown

Ruby integration of Styledown.

Status

Ruby integration

# Gemfile
gem 'styledown'

Gem

Plain Ruby integration

API for Styledown.parse is exactly the same as the JS version (docs).

require 'styledown'

# Passing a Styledown sting:
Styledown.parse('### hello', bare: true)

# Parsing files from disk:
Styledown.parse([
    '/path/to/input.css',
    '/path/to/input.md',
    '...'
])

# Parsing files from elsewhere:
Styledown.parse([
  { name: "input.md",  data: "### hi from md" },
  { name: "input.css", data: "/**\n * hi from css:\n * world\n */" }
])

©️

styledown © 2014+, Rico Sta. Cruz. Released under the MIT License.
Authored and maintained by Rico Sta. Cruz with help from contributors.

ricostacruz.com  ·  GitHub @rstacruz  ·  Twitter @rstacruz